BYD opens its first electric vehicle factory in Thailand despite worldwide tariff issues.
Reading
BYD, a Chinese car company, opened its first factory in Thailand. The factory will make electric vehicles, batteries, and transmissions.
This is part of BYD's plan to sell more cars in Southeast Asia. They also want to sell more cars in the U.S. and Europe.
However, the U.S. and Europe are concerned about Chinese electric cars being cheaper. They are increasing taxes on Chinese electric cars.
The new factory in Thailand is very big and can make many cars. It was built very quickly, in just 16 months.
BYD wants to sell many electric cars in Thailand. They hope to sell cars like the Dolphin, Atto 3, Seal, and Sealion 6.
